There is a larger number of a hydrophilic molecules on the outside of a cell than on the inside Identify the conditions that could equalize the intracellular and extracellular concentrations of this molecule. Select all that apply. placing intracellularly directed and extracellularly directed pumps in the membrane placing only intracellularly-directed pomps in the membrane not inserting any transport proteins in the membrane Placing channel proteins in the membrane Which of the conditions would be the most metabolically efficient way for a cell to equalize the intracellular and extracellular concentrations of this molecule? not inserting any transport proteins in the membrane placing channel proteins in the membrane placing only intracellularly-directed pumps in the membrane placing intracellularly directed and extracellularly directed pumps in the membrane

Explanation / Answer

Question answer Identify the conditions that could equalize the intracellular and extracellular concentrations of this molecule. placing intracellularly directed and extracellularly directed pumps in the membrane . Placing channel proteins in the membrane Which of the conditions would be the most metabolically efficient way for a cell to equalize the intracellular and extracellular concentrations of this molecule? Placing channel proteins in the membrane.
